  • Start early: Plan your move well in advance to ensure you have enough time to pack, clean, and organize.
  • Declutter: Sort through your belongings and get rid of items you no longer need. This will make packing and unpacking easier.
  • Make a list: Write down a list of all the items you need to move, including their dimensions and weight. This will help you determine what type of moving truck you need.
  • Label boxes: Label boxes clearly with their contents and the room they belong in. This will make unpacking easier and faster.
  • Pack carefully: Use high-quality packing materials and make sure items are packed securely to prevent damage during transport.
  • Hire professional movers: Consider hiring a full-service moving company like Bearded Brothers Moving Group, LLC, to handle the heavy lifting and transport of your belongings.
  • Update your address: Notify your utility companies, the post office, and other important organizations of your new address.
  • Take an inventory: Take an inventory of your belongings before they are loaded onto the moving truck, and keep this list with you throughout the move.

Packing

Hiring a residential moving company for packing and unpacking services can be a huge time saver and help ensure that your items are safely transported to your new home. This service can also be particularly helpful for those who have young children or special needs who are used to a particular routine or comfort level in their homes.

Professional movers will have the necessary tools and experience to pack your belongings effectively. They can easily identify delicate or breakable items and make sure that they are packed securely. They will also label each box so that you know exactly where it came from and what is in it.

Packing is a vital step in any move, but it can be especially difficult for busy people. Even if you have friends and family members who can help, it is still a lot of work to do in advance of the move.

To reduce the stress of the packing process, you should prepare weeks or months in advance. This includes packing away seasonal clothes, books and other belongings that will not be needed after you have moved. It is also a good idea to clear shelves and remove items from walls that may cause damage when the movers are loading them onto the truck.

Another benefit of hiring a professional to pack is that they can do it quickly and efficiently. Typically, it takes less time for them to pack a studio or one-bedroom apartment than it does for you to do it on your own.

This will reduce the stress of your move and leave you with more time to spend focusing on other aspects of the moving process. This is especially important for those who are moving with kids or have a busy job that leaves them little time to pack and unpack their belongings.

The cost of a professional packer depends on the amount of work that is required and how much time it will take them to complete the task. These professionals charge an hourly rate and will give you a cost estimate before the job begins.

Insurance

Moving can be a stressful process, and it’s important to have the right moving company on your side to ensure your belongings are protected from damage. One way to achieve this is through the use of insurance.

There are several types of insurance coverage available to consumers when they hire a residential moving company. These include released value protection (level-value), full value coverage, and general liability.

Released value protection – Required by federal law, this type of coverage covers the contents of a shipment for 60 cents per pound of the load. It’s a good choice for many items, including books, electronics, clothing, and appliances.

However, this policy may not be enough to cover the most expensive or valuable items in your possession. If you have an extensive collection of antiques, high-end furniture or other rare and precious items, you should purchase additional insurance through a third-party provider to help cover your losses.

Full value coverage – Another requirement of federal law, this type of insurance pays for the current market replacement value, or replacement with a comparable item, if an item is lost or damaged. This coverage is often more expensive, but it can provide a good amount of peace of mind for your belongings.

You can get this type of coverage by signing a valuation agreement with your moving company. This agreement defines how the moving company will determine the replacement value of your items if they’re damaged or lost during transport.

Your mover must give you a copy of the valuation agreement before they begin packing your goods. They must also inform you of the cost of the coverage and any deductibles that apply.
